> On Thu, Jul 23, 2026 at 09:15:05 -0400, Robert Heller wrote:
> > On a fresh install of trixie (Debian 13), I am getting this message.  Where is
> > it coming from?
> > 
> > The message is:
> > 
> > cannot stat /var/run/utmp.  Please "unset watch".
> 
> It would help enormously if you told us what command you ran to produce
> the message.

I'm not running any partitular command.  This message occurs at every shell 
prompt.  I do have a set prompt in my .cshrc (I am using tcsh as my shell):

#
# set prompt
#
set me = `whoami`
if ("$me" != "root") set prompt="`hostname`% "
if ("$me" == "root") set prompt="`hostname`# "
#


> 
> That said, the utmp file is no longer supported, partly because its
> format is incompatible with 64-bit time_t.
